Celebrate Dr. Seuss Day in Grey Towers Castle on Feb. 22

By Purnell T. Cropper | January 8, 2015

Arcadia University’s Office of Community Service is celebrating Dr. Seuss Day on Sunday, Feb. 22, from 1 to 3 p.m. in Grey Towers Castle with a Dr. Seuss Day event. Children in grades K-3 accompanied by an adult are invited to enjoy a fun-filled day of activities including bingo, face painting, storytelling, button making, obstacle courses, memory games, and freeze dancing.

Students, faculty, and staff can participate by volunteering with the children (a variety of positions are available) or by making a Dr. Seuss themed cake for a cake decorating competition.

The Dr. Seuss event was established in honor of Jami Rodriguez, an Arcadia alumna, and continues in her memory. The event is free but donations are accepted and will go toward the Jami Rodriguez Scholarship, which recognizes the contributions current full-time undergraduates have made to campus life through dedication to community service.
